1 Robinhood: Best for Beginners
Overview:
Robinhood is a popular U.S. investment app. Its commission-free trading and user-friendly design make it ideal for newcomers. New investors like the program because they can trade stocks, options, and cryptocurrencies without costs.
Features:
– Free trading Trades are commission-free, which is great for small investors.
Robinhood lets you buy fractional shares of pricey stocks, so you can invest with a tiny budget.
User-friendly interface: For novice investors, the software is simple and intuitive.

2. Acorns: Best Automatic Investing
Overview:
The innovative Acorns app rounds up your daily purchases and invests the spare change, making investing easy. For investors who don’t have time to physically buy stocks or bonds, it’s ideal. Acorns automatically invests spare change in a diversified ETF portfolio.
The following features are available:
– Acorns rounds up purchases to the nearest dollar and invests the difference.
Automatic portfolios: Acorns builds a portfolio depending on your retirement or financial goals.
Easy withdrawals: It’s meant to help you save, yet you can withdraw money simply.

3. Betterment: Best for Long-Term Investors
Overview:
The Betterment robo-advisor software lets investors develop diversified portfolios for their financial goals. This tool employs modern portfolio theory to construct low-cost, long-term investing strategies for investors who want to invest without spending too much time monitoring their portfolios.
To stay on pace with your goals, Betterment automatically rebalances your portfolio.
Betterment provides personalized investment optimization and tax reduction guidance.
The app features low administration fees, so you keep more of your returns.

4. Stash: Best for Learning While Investing
Overview:
Learning and investing are combined in Stash, an investment app. It provides financial training in bite-sized chunks for beginning investors. Stash makes building a portfolio with a few bucks easy.
Features:
– Stash offers fractional shares for diversification on a limited budget.
Educational resources: The software teaches beginners about investing and the stock market.
Stash provides low monthly fees and no minimum deposit, making it accessible to smaller investors.

5 Fidelity Investments: Best for Comprehensive Investing
Overview:
One of the oldest and most recognized financial firms is Fidelity. Their app is perfect for new and experienced investors. Fidelity is one of the more adaptable options, including low-cost index funds, retirement accounts, and full-service financial consulting.
Features:
– Fidelity offers a diverse choice of investments, including equities, ETFs, mutual funds, and more.
Retirement planning: IRAs and 401(k)s are easy to open and administer.
Fidelity offers strong research and instructional tools to help you make educated decisions.
